This year is our biggest garden ever. We have 4 large plots we are using.
My husband is busy watching out over his plot of:
Popcorn
Giant sunflowers
Cushaw Pumpkins
Giant Pumpkins
Spaghetti Squash
I have planted in three other large plots:
Silver Queen corn
Chubby Checker corn
Early Yellow corn
Ruby Queen corn
Snap beans
Pink Eye peas
Purple skinned potatoes
Sweet Georgia Onions
8 types of tomatoes
5 lettuces
spinach
2 kinds of yellow squash
2 kinds of zucchini squash
Sugar snaps
Sweet peas
Kentucky wonder beans
Asparagus beans
Asparagus
Artichokes
Rhubarb
Turnips
Collards
Sweet peppers
Hot peppers
Banana Peppers
Herbs: dill, tarragon, thyme, 2 kinds of parsley, 2 kinds of basil, rosemary, oregano, cilantro, among other common herbs
We also put in some new fruit trees. We already have several apple trees and damson trees. This year we put in 3 fig trees and 4 blueberry bushes.
I always have great ambition as the long days of winter drag on. The first days of spring set me into motion.
This year I am very excited over some of our first tries with the asparagus and artichokes.
